I have a carbine with a 18" barrel and want to cut it down to 16".  If I put an empty shell into the chamber and seat it fully, then measure the distance from the crown to base of shell will that give me my OAL of barrel?  Thanks
Link Posted: 10/31/2001 5:42:45 PM EDT
[#1]
Have the barrel professionally cut and refinished by someone like Kurt, especially if it is chrome-lined.

Otherwise, the barrel length is measured from the face of the closed bolt to the muzzle.  Simply close the bolt, insert a cleaning rod until it contacts the bolt face.  Mark the rod where it emerges from the muzzle and measure the rod from end to mark.
